The parties celebrate the victory – LDK celebrates in Pristina, LVV in Mitrovica and Fushë Kosovë

Prishtina, one of the municipalities where votes were cast in the second round of elections, did not change its mayor, confirming the LDK candidate Përparim Rama. The latter won the race against Hajrullah Çeku. After this victory, the LVV candidate accepted the defeat and congratulated Rama, expressing that he hopes that Pristina will get out of the difficulties in which, according to him, it has been involved in recent years. So the Democratic League of Kosovo called the result in Pristina a victory for all of Kosovo.

I especially want to thank the 47,000 voters of Pristina who once again confirmed our victory. Today’s victory is not only the victory of the LDK, it is the victory of the whole of Kosovo, of the hope of the great national renaissance, and with this victory I mean that there are no losers at all. Progress Rama is the president of every citizen of Pristina, both those who voted for us and those who did not vote for us. We are too few to be divided and divided”, Lumir Abdixhiku, Head of LDK.

Today is the victory of all citizens of the capital, today is the victory of all of Kosovo. Prishtina showed that it wants development, Prishtina showed that it does not want deadlock. We move forward to the right of development, we say no to sabotage”, said Përparim Rama, LDK candidate for Pristina.

The Vetëvendosje movement celebrated the victory of its candidates in South Mitrovica, Fushë Kosovë and Obiliq. Mayor Albin Kurti said that his candidates for mayor have fought an extraordinary battle.

AAK leader Ramush Haradinaj also assessed the results of the runoff as successful, whose party won in 4 municipalities. According to the preliminary results of the Central Election Commission, LDK won in five municipalities, LVV and AAK in four each and PDK in three municipalities.
